冥王生活

您现在的位置是:首页 > 科技生活 > 正文

科技生活

为什么学编程(为什么学编程那么贵)

admin2022-11-19科技生活124

为什么要学编程

学编程这件事并不少见,大部分来说是有益的,他可以帮助我们解决很多遇到的生活问题,下面是我总结的关于学习编程的好处。

增加小孩抽象思考能力

其实学写编程,就像学习第二外国语一样。如果说学外文是为了跟外国人沟通,学写编程就是学习怎么跟电脑沟通。有趣的是,你碰到老外不会说英文还可以比手画脚,跟电脑可不行。这表示孩子在学习的过程中,更需要一种把抽象化为具体的能力,好让不懂得思考的电脑,也能了解与表达抽象的事物。

帮助小孩整理信息,吸收融合能力

写程序说穿了,就是一堆电脑指令的排列组合。好比小学的时候我们查字典学汉字、学成语,之后学习如何利用习得的汉字、成语组成句子,进而撰写文章一样。程式中的基本指令就是汉字,写成可重复利用的 Function 或 Module 就像是成语,然而最终要完成一个有头有尾的程式时,则必须融会贯通,学以致用,确保程序在执行中不会出现矛盾的情形导致 Crash。

提升国际性的沟通能力、竞争力

显而易见,现在哪一门行业不用电脑?哪一个行业可以完全不需要接触电脑?如同先前提过的,电脑语言,已然成为一个重要的沟通工具,不但是跟电脑沟通,还有跟所有运用电脑的人沟通。小孩在幼时接触的环境,往往跟以后的发展有极大的关联性。

如果不想跟世界脱轨,尽早让他了解所谓的编写程序,或是了解编程是怎么一回事将会是他们面对国际竞争时有力的武器。

总结

学校计算机编程的好处多多,但也并不是所有人都要学习编程的,这要看个人的兴趣爱好,和以后的想法,我学习编程就是为了以后的工作做准备。

为什么要学习编程语言

为什么要学习编程语言

第一,现阶段孩子的编程基本上就是一个逻辑思维的表达,孩子学习编程有助于孩子锻炼逻辑思维能力,提高做事情的逻辑性。

第二,编程需要细致严谨,某一步某一个点没有考虑到,都会导致失败,所以更能培训孩子的细心耐心和思维严谨性,这些品质对于孩子的学校学习也是非常有帮助的。

第三,编程富教于乐,孩子喜欢玩,更容易接受,现在孩子大多数爱电子产品,家长严厉制止只会激发孩子逆反心理,可能玩得更厉害,堵不如疏,与其让他们玩一些无意义的东西,不如让他们编程,即可以满足他们接触电子产品的心理又可以学习一些有意义的事,一举两得。

编程的优势

编程的优势是易学且功能强大,有助于发挥自己的想象力,而在动手创作过程中,他们的学习积极性、想象力和创造力会得到极大的锻炼,孩子们可以用少儿编程中已有的素材,发挥自己的想象力制作游戏、动画,还可以自己设计素材。

除此之外,孩子在学习图形化编程的过程中会不断地尝试、不断地面对挑战、不断地经历失败,不断地从错误中学习,只有经历了这些,才能最终获得程序的正确运行。

为什么要学习编程

除了高就业率和高薪,编程还给我们带来什么? 

1.理性思考方式

人人都应该学习一门计算机语言,因为它将教会你如何思考——史蒂夫·乔布斯

在计算机的世界中,一切都遵循着非0即1的基本原则,它教会我们当一个错误出现时,不要试图不加修正,重新执行一次程序,我们就会得到正确的结果,让我们不再心存侥幸,直面问题。

反省自己能力,机器是客观存在的实体,不具有情感,这是它最大的缺陷,也是最大的优势。例如,在人际交往沟通产生矛盾时,我们争论不休,总把问题推诿给别人,但在机器的世界里,却是截然不同的一种想象,因为我们的对手是绝对理性的,绝对不会欺骗我们,如果出现问题,我们只能从自身着手去查找问题根据,因为问题一定在于我们自身,孔夫子的“吾日三省吾身”在此再也贴切不过。

2.计算思维方式

计算思维是每个人(而不仅仅是计算机科学家)都应该具备的基本技能,计算思维同阅读,写作和算术一样,应当成为孩子们必备的分析能力。——Jeannette Wing

计算思维是利用计算机科学解决问题的一种强有力的思维方式,通过收集数据、分析数据来理解和思考问题,这也是然我们叹为观止的人工智能进化路线,建立数据模型,收集大数据,将数据输入模型进行深度学习,不断迭代完善模型,从而具备表现智能的能力。在学习编程中,潜移默化在培养我们定义问题,抽象模型,解决问题的能力。

3.综合素质教育

STEAM由科学(Science),技术(Technology),工程(Engineering),艺术(Arts),数学(Mathematical)五个部分组成。Georgette Yakman使用一个形象的金字塔结构详细描述了五个部分的关系。STEAM教育方式,其主要理念就是通过多学科融合,培养人全方位的能力,充分挖掘人自己未知的潜力。对于现在的儿童来说,通过学习编程就可以培养上面所有的能力。软件编程首先是一门工程学,把创意想法变成真实的作品我们需要学习科学技术,按照工程学的方法论规划实施,同样的,优秀的软件也离不开优雅的艺术设计,最后,如果我们想进一步探索计算机的奥秘,当我们深入其基本原理时,我们又必须提升自己的数学能力。

适应时代发展,随着移动互联网和人工智能的发展,我们越来越多的时间将被电脑所占据,例如看视频,浏览新闻,玩游戏,但我们并没有更多的机会进行创作,而编程则给了我们创作的机会,让设备成为工具,让我们的定位从消费者变成创造者,实现自己的创意,影响改变着社会;另一方面,从智力开发上来说,学编程不意味着将来要从事计算机开发工作,通过学习编程能够开拓儿童的逻辑能力、思维的缜密性、提高创造力。

总的来说,在工业时代,我们使用文字绘画图片表达我们心中的想法,创意;在互联网时代,编程将成为我们想象力,创造力最直观的表达窗口。因此,我们学习编程的目的并不是培养技能和未来的程序员,而是要懂得如何使用科技表达自己的创意。Nowadays, even children begin  to learn Child programming at . Because the future is the era of artificial intelligence.

发表评论

评论列表

  • 这篇文章还没有收到评论,赶紧来抢沙发吧~